Tree Crown Shaping services involve the careful trimming and pruning of a tree's uppermost branches to achieve a desired form or size. This process typically focuses on maintaining the natural aesthetic of the tree while ensuring it remains healthy and well-balanced. Skilled professionals utilize specialized techniques to selectively remove or prune branches, promoting a more uniform and attractive crown. The goal is often to improve the overall appearance of the tree, enhance light penetration, or reduce the risk of branch failure.
These services help address several common problems associated with overgrown or misshapen tree crowns. For example, unbalanced or heavily branched trees can pose safety hazards, especially during storms or high winds. Overgrown crowns can also interfere with structures, power lines, or obstruct views. Additionally, poorly maintained crowns may lead to uneven growth or increased susceptibility to pests and diseases. Tree crown shaping can help mitigate these issues by promoting healthier growth patterns and reducing potential hazards.

The overview below groups typical Tree Crown Sha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oakland,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Crown Shaping - The cost typically ranges from $150 to $400 for small to medium-sized trees. This service involves light trimming to improve shape and health. Larger or more complex jobs may cost more depending on the tree's size and condition.
Moderate Crown Reshaping - Expect prices between $400 and $800 for more extensive crown adjustments. This includes significant pruning to balance the tree’s appearance and remove dead or overgrown branches. Costs vary based on tree height and accessibility.
Advanced Crown Thinning - Prices usually fall between $500 and $1,200 for comprehensive thinning to reduce weight and improve light penetration. This service often involves careful removal of interior branches and can depend on tree size and complexity.
Complete Crown Restoration - The cost can range from $1,000 to over $2,500 for full crown shaping and health restoration. This extensive work may include crown reduction, removal of damaged branches, and detailed shaping by local pros. Costs depend on the scope of the project and tree condition.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
Tree Crown Shaping services involve contouring and pruning tree canopies to promote healthy growth and improve appearance. Local professionals can help create a balanced and aesthetically pleasing crown for various tree species.
Tree Crown Thinning focuses on selectively removing branches to reduce weight and improve airflow within the canopy, which can enhance overall tree health and stability.
Tree Crown Reduction services are used to decrease the size of a tree’s canopy, helping to prevent interference with structures or power lines while maintaining the tree’s natural form.
Structural Tree Crown Pruning aims to remove weak or crossing branches to strengthen the tree’s structure and reduce the risk of storm damage or limb failure.
Selective Crown Shaping involves precise pruning to refine the tree’s shape, ensuring it complements the landscape while supporting healthy growth patterns.
Formative Crown Shaping services are typically performed on younger trees to establish a strong and healthy growth structure for future development.
